AR VR Security and Compliance in New Zealand

AR VR applications can process personal information, images, voice, movement, location and behavioural data depending on the experience. We consider privacy, accessibility, security and device requirements throughout application design and development.

New Zealand regulatory compliance for AR VR development

NZ Compliance

New Zealand Regulatory Compliance

AR VR applications can be designed around applicable New Zealand privacy, accessibility, consumer and information handling requirements.

  • Privacy Act 2020 considerations
  • Personal information handling
  • Camera and sensor permissions
  • Location data considerations
  • Consent management
  • Biometric data assessment
  • Accessibility considerations
  • Data retention planning
  • Secure data transmission
  • Privacy focused experience design

Transparent Pricing

Understand Your AR VR Development Costin Auckland?

AR VR app development cost in New Zealand depends on the type of experience, target devices, 3D assets, interaction complexity, backend requirements, AI or computer vision features, integrations and testing. A focused AR VR prototype may range from NZD 20K to NZD 50K, a production immersive application from NZD 50K to NZD 120K, and a complex enterprise AR VR platform from NZD 120K to NZD 250K plus.
